A lot of writing going on the past few days and today on Minnesota Republicans and the leadership's struggle to right the ship. MPR's Capitol View blog reports:
Several Republican senators are starting to suggest that if they were in Sen. Amy Koch's position they would resign instead of bringing further attention to the scandal.More stories and opinions on the GOP, its present and future.The comments came just two days after senators admitted publicly that they confronted Koch about an inappropriate relationship with a Senate staffer.
Koch has not made any public statements since she announced she was resigning her leadership position on Thursday.
The scramble to see who will be the next majority leader is also starting behind the scenes. Dave Thompson has already told reporters that he's considering the job.
